healthcare assistant

Responsibility

  • act as a chaperone for other staff during medical procedures, providing support and comfort to patients
  • perform competent phlebotomy as per medical requests, ensuring accurate labelling and logging of samples
  • provide injection teaching sessions and assist with the completion of consent forms, checklists, and updates on the IDEAS patient portal
  • report any stock needs to the Team Leader/Deputy Manager and assist with pharmacy quality management tasks
  • coordinate with pharmacy suppliers to ensure timely prescription deliveries and manage associated administrative tasks
  • ensure safe disposal of sharps and waste management in compliance with protocols
